November 15, 1987: What happened on that day?
Here's what happened on November 15, 1987:
- Carla beurskens runs dutch female record marathon
- Leile mcbridge (denver), crowned miss black america
- New york giant raul allegre kicks 2, 50 or more yard field goals in a game
- Continental airlines flight 1713, a douglas dc-9-14 jetliner, crashes in a snowstorm at denver, colorado stapleton international airport, killing 28 occupants, while 54 survive the crash.
- In braşov, romania, workers rebel against the communist regime led by nicolae ceaușescu.
- Continental airlines flight 1713 crashes during takeoff from stapleton international airport in denver, colorado, killing 25.

November 15, 1987: What was the moon phase on that day?
Moon phase
The moon phase on November 15, 1987 was Last Quarter.
The moon phase refers to the appearance of the Moon in the night sky on November 15, 1987 and is determined by the portion of the Moon's illuminated surface that is visible from Earth.
An observer located in New York City on November 15, 1987 at 10pm, would see the moon, being 21% full, rising at 12:36 am and setting at 02:13 pm.
The previous full moon was on Nov 05, 1987 while the next full moon would come on Dec 05, 1987.

November 15, 1987: What was the number 1 song in the UK on that day?
The number 1 song in the UK on November 15, 1987 was China In Your Hand by T'Pau, according to the music chart for the week November 9th and November 15th.
November 15, 1987: What was the music chart in the UK on that day?
The music chart in the UK on November 15, 1987 is the list of the most popular songs across all genres for the week November 9th and November 15th. It included the following Top 5 songs:
- T'Pau - China In Your Hand
- George Harrison - Got My Mind Set On You
- Rick Astley - Whenever You Need Somebody
- The Bee Gees - You Win Again
- The Communards - Never Can Say Goodbye
November 15, 1987: What was the number 1 R&B song on that day?
The number 1 R&B song on November 15, 1987 was Angel by Angela Winbush, according to the R&B music chart for the week November 9th and November 15th.
November 15, 1987: What was the R&B music chart on that day?
The R&B music chart on November 15, 1987 is the list of the most popular R&B songs for the week November 9th and November 15th. It included the following Top 5 R&B songs:
- Angela Winbush - Angel
- Deja - You And Me Tonight
- Marlon Jackson - Don't Go
- The O'Jays - Lovin' You
- Stevie Wonder - Skeletons
